| int german_ISO_8859_1_stem | ( | struct SN_env * | z | ) |
Definition at line 461 of file stem_ISO_8859_1_german.c.
References SN_env::c, SN_env::l, SN_env::lb, r_mark_regions(), r_postlude(), r_prelude(), and r_standard_suffix().
{
{ int c1 = z->c; /* do, line 125 */
{ int ret = r_prelude(z);
if (ret == 0) goto lab0; /* call prelude, line 125 */
if (ret < 0) return ret;
}
lab0:
z->c = c1;
}
{ int c2 = z->c; /* do, line 126 */
{ int ret = r_mark_regions(z);
if (ret == 0) goto lab1; /* call mark_regions, line 126 */
if (ret < 0) return ret;
}
lab1:
z->c = c2;
}
z->lb = z->c; z->c = z->l; /* backwards, line 127 */
{ int m3 = z->l - z->c; (void)m3; /* do, line 128 */
{ int ret = r_standard_suffix(z);
if (ret == 0) goto lab2; /* call standard_suffix, line 128 */
if (ret < 0) return ret;
}
lab2:
z->c = z->l - m3;
}
z->c = z->lb;
{ int c4 = z->c; /* do, line 129 */
{ int ret = r_postlude(z);
if (ret == 0) goto lab3; /* call postlude, line 129 */
if (ret < 0) return ret;
}
lab3:
z->c = c4;
}
return 1;
}
| static int r_mark_regions | ( | struct SN_env * | z | ) | [static] |
Definition at line 196 of file stem_ISO_8859_1_german.c.
References SN_env::c, g_v, SN_env::I, in_grouping(), SN_env::l, and out_grouping().
Referenced by german_ISO_8859_1_stem().
{
z->I[0] = z->l;
z->I[1] = z->l;
{ int c_test = z->c; /* test, line 47 */
{ int ret = z->c + 3;
if (0 > ret || ret > z->l) return 0;
z->c = ret; /* hop, line 47 */
}
z->I[2] = z->c; /* setmark x, line 47 */
z->c = c_test;
}
{ /* gopast */ /* grouping v, line 49 */
int ret = out_grouping(z, g_v, 97, 252, 1);
if (ret < 0) return 0;
z->c += ret;
}
{ /* gopast */ /* non v, line 49 */
int ret = in_grouping(z, g_v, 97, 252, 1);
if (ret < 0) return 0;
z->c += ret;
}
z->I[0] = z->c; /* setmark p1, line 49 */
/* try, line 50 */
if (!(z->I[0] < z->I[2])) goto lab0;
z->I[0] = z->I[2];
lab0:
{ /* gopast */ /* grouping v, line 51 */
int ret = out_grouping(z, g_v, 97, 252, 1);
if (ret < 0) return 0;
z->c += ret;
}
{ /* gopast */ /* non v, line 51 */
int ret = in_grouping(z, g_v, 97, 252, 1);
if (ret < 0) return 0;
z->c += ret;
}
z->I[1] = z->c; /* setmark p2, line 51 */
return 1;
}

| static int r_standard_suffix | ( | struct SN_env * | z | ) | [static] |
Definition at line 294 of file stem_ISO_8859_1_german.c.
References SN_env::bra, SN_env::c, eq_s_b(), find_among_b(), g_s_ending, g_st_ending, in_grouping_b(), SN_env::ket, SN_env::l, SN_env::lb, SN_env::p, r_R1(), r_R2(), s_11, s_12, s_13, s_14, s_15, and slice_del().
Referenced by german_ISO_8859_1_stem().
{
int among_var;
{ int m1 = z->l - z->c; (void)m1; /* do, line 74 */
z->ket = z->c; /* [, line 75 */
if (z->c <= z->lb || z->p[z->c - 1] >> 5 != 3 || !((811040 >> (z->p[z->c - 1] & 0x1f)) & 1)) goto lab0;
among_var = find_among_b(z, a_1, 7); /* substring, line 75 */
if (!(among_var)) goto lab0;
z->bra = z->c; /* ], line 75 */
{ int ret = r_R1(z);
if (ret == 0) goto lab0; /* call R1, line 75 */
if (ret < 0) return ret;
}
switch(among_var) {
case 0: goto lab0;
case 1:
{ int ret = slice_del(z); /* delete, line 77 */
if (ret < 0) return ret;
}
break;
case 2:
if (in_grouping_b(z, g_s_ending, 98, 116, 0)) goto lab0;
{ int ret = slice_del(z); /* delete, line 80 */
if (ret < 0) return ret;
}
break;
}
lab0:
z->c = z->l - m1;
}
{ int m2 = z->l - z->c; (void)m2; /* do, line 84 */
z->ket = z->c; /* [, line 85 */
if (z->c - 1 <= z->lb || z->p[z->c - 1] >> 5 != 3 || !((1327104 >> (z->p[z->c - 1] & 0x1f)) & 1)) goto lab1;
among_var = find_among_b(z, a_2, 4); /* substring, line 85 */
if (!(among_var)) goto lab1;
z->bra = z->c; /* ], line 85 */
{ int ret = r_R1(z);
if (ret == 0) goto lab1; /* call R1, line 85 */
if (ret < 0) return ret;
}
switch(among_var) {
case 0: goto lab1;
case 1:
{ int ret = slice_del(z); /* delete, line 87 */
if (ret < 0) return ret;
}
break;
case 2:
if (in_grouping_b(z, g_st_ending, 98, 116, 0)) goto lab1;
{ int ret = z->c - 3;
if (z->lb > ret || ret > z->l) goto lab1;
z->c = ret; /* hop, line 90 */
}
{ int ret = slice_del(z); /* delete, line 90 */
if (ret < 0) return ret;
}
break;
}
lab1:
z->c = z->l - m2;
}
{ int m3 = z->l - z->c; (void)m3; /* do, line 94 */
z->ket = z->c; /* [, line 95 */
if (z->c - 1 <= z->lb || z->p[z->c - 1] >> 5 != 3 || !((1051024 >> (z->p[z->c - 1] & 0x1f)) & 1)) goto lab2;
among_var = find_among_b(z, a_4, 8); /* substring, line 95 */
if (!(among_var)) goto lab2;
z->bra = z->c; /* ], line 95 */
{ int ret = r_R2(z);
if (ret == 0) goto lab2; /* call R2, line 95 */
if (ret < 0) return ret;
}
switch(among_var) {
case 0: goto lab2;
case 1:
{ int ret = slice_del(z); /* delete, line 97 */
if (ret < 0) return ret;
}
{ int m_keep = z->l - z->c;/* (void) m_keep;*/ /* try, line 98 */
z->ket = z->c; /* [, line 98 */
if (!(eq_s_b(z, 2, s_11))) { z->c = z->l - m_keep; goto lab3; }
z->bra = z->c; /* ], line 98 */
{ int m4 = z->l - z->c; (void)m4; /* not, line 98 */
if (!(eq_s_b(z, 1, s_12))) goto lab4;
{ z->c = z->l - m_keep; goto lab3; }
lab4:
z->c = z->l - m4;
}
{ int ret = r_R2(z);
if (ret == 0) { z->c = z->l - m_keep; goto lab3; } /* call R2, line 98 */
if (ret < 0) return ret;
}
{ int ret = slice_del(z); /* delete, line 98 */
if (ret < 0) return ret;
}
lab3:
;
}
break;
case 2:
{ int m5 = z->l - z->c; (void)m5; /* not, line 101 */
if (!(eq_s_b(z, 1, s_13))) goto lab5;
goto lab2;
lab5:
z->c = z->l - m5;
}
{ int ret = slice_del(z); /* delete, line 101 */
if (ret < 0) return ret;
}
break;
case 3:
{ int ret = slice_del(z); /* delete, line 104 */
if (ret < 0) return ret;
}
{ int m_keep = z->l - z->c;/* (void) m_keep;*/ /* try, line 105 */
z->ket = z->c; /* [, line 106 */
{ int m6 = z->l - z->c; (void)m6; /* or, line 106 */
if (!(eq_s_b(z, 2, s_14))) goto lab8;
goto lab7;
lab8:
z->c = z->l - m6;
if (!(eq_s_b(z, 2, s_15))) { z->c = z->l - m_keep; goto lab6; }
}
lab7:
z->bra = z->c; /* ], line 106 */
{ int ret = r_R1(z);
if (ret == 0) { z->c = z->l - m_keep; goto lab6; } /* call R1, line 106 */
if (ret < 0) return ret;
}
{ int ret = slice_del(z); /* delete, line 106 */
if (ret < 0) return ret;
}
lab6:
;
}
break;
case 4:
{ int ret = slice_del(z); /* delete, line 110 */
if (ret < 0) return ret;
}
{ int m_keep = z->l - z->c;/* (void) m_keep;*/ /* try, line 111 */
z->ket = z->c; /* [, line 112 */
if (z->c - 1 <= z->lb || (z->p[z->c - 1] != 103 && z->p[z->c - 1] != 104)) { z->c = z->l - m_keep; goto lab9; }
among_var = find_among_b(z, a_3, 2); /* substring, line 112 */
if (!(among_var)) { z->c = z->l - m_keep; goto lab9; }
z->bra = z->c; /* ], line 112 */
{ int ret = r_R2(z);
if (ret == 0) { z->c = z->l - m_keep; goto lab9; } /* call R2, line 112 */
if (ret < 0) return ret;
}
switch(among_var) {
case 0: { z->c = z->l - m_keep; goto lab9; }
case 1:
{ int ret = slice_del(z); /* delete, line 114 */
if (ret < 0) return ret;
}
break;
}
lab9:
;
}
break;
}
lab2:
z->c = z->l - m3;
}
return 1;
}
